Importance of Naufasan Tavol Customs and Culture In Murut culture, hunting is a Naufasan that has been practised since our ancestors’ time. Therefore, the extinction of animals or resources in the Iningaan Mai can happen if there is no control or management system in place. Tavol is practised to ensure resources in the Iningaan Mai is maintained and this traditional knowledge can be passed down to future generations. Furthermore, through Tavol, the community is taught to be more cooperative and it instils a sense of responsibility in them. The success of any given Tavol depends on the cooperation within the community. Traditional customs or customary law can also be strengthened through Tavol. The whole community has to follow the customary law or rules that has been decided together and will feel ashamed if they violate the rules. Natural Resources In the balance of natural resources, Tavol ensures that there is continuity of resources. Through this Naufasan, human activities can be controlled.
